Verdict

Jackson and Meridian are closely matched on overall financial advisor compensation, each winning on different metrics.

The salary gap between Jackson and Meridian is $3,619 (4.28%). Meridian's median is -18.76% compared to the US national median of $108,537.

Salary Range Comparison

The full salary range (10th to 90th percentile) in Jackson spans $291,244,Meridian spans $85,534. Jackson has a wider pay range, meaning more potential for high earners but also more variation.

Cost-of-Living Adjusted Comparison

After cost-of-living adjustment, Meridian ($102,894 effective) pays 8.35% more than Jackson ($94,961 effective).

Historical Salary Growth Comparison

Based on BLS OEWS metropolitan area data, financial advisor salaries in Jackson grew -1.7% from 2019 to 2025, compared to 54.5% growth in Meridian over the same period.

Methodology & Data Source

All salary figures are 2026 projections based on BLS OEWS May 2025 data. A 3.30% CAGR (derived from 6-year national BLS trends) was applied to estimate current compensation. Cost-of-living adjustments use BEA Regional Price Parity data. Actual salaries vary by employer, certifications, and experience.
